Energy calculated at B1B95/6-31G(2df,p)
 hartrees
Energy at 0K-323.644132
Energy at 298.15K-323.653312
Nuclear repulsion energy247.674855
The energy at 298.15K was derived from the energy at 0K and an integrated heat capacity that used the calculated vibrational frequencies.
